Unless there is some pressing reason you want to pick up your bags yourself, you don't need to go to baggage claim. If you want DME to take care of your luggage for you, you will have to affix the yellow DME luggage tags to each checked bag. Then...say goodby to them, until they arrive at your resort. Yes, it does take a few hours (3 or so from the time of resort checkin) for the luggage to get to your room. But, you should always pack a carryon bag with any essentials for the first part of your arrival day...the airlines could misdirect your bag(s) and if you have a carryon packed, you can go about your day, without those checked bags right there.
If, for whatever reason, you want to collect your own checked bags...do not tag them with the yellow tags. (those yellow tags alert the baggage handlers that the bag is going to a WDW resort, on a special luggage truck. they are pulled out and set aside, they aren't supposed to make it out to the public baggage claim). So...you will go to the appropriate baggage claim area for your airline...Side A baggage claim if arriving on Side A, or baggage claim for Side B if arriving over there.
Then, you will need to go to Side B, level 1 to get to DME. If you are already on Side B, baggage claim (level 2), you just need to go down a level. If on Side A, you will need to go to level 2 to get your bags, then up to level 3 (the level you arrived on), cross over to Side B, and go down to level 1 for DME.
